The Muckrake Political Podcast podcast

The Muckrake Political Podcast

CLNS Media Network

The Muckrake Podcast is the political podcast that promises to dig deeper. Political analysts Jared Yates Sexton and Nick Hauselman tackle the news of the day but go beyond the stale and tired narratives to provide historical context and alternative perspectives, all to bring a little order to chaotic times.

433 Episódios